Duties
- Lead and supervise all pharmacy activities, ensuring adherence to legal and regulatory requirements such as HIPAA and state pharmacy laws
- Oversee medication dispensing processes, including Immunization.
- Manage inventory levels efficiently to prevent shortages or overstocking, including medication storage and controlled substances
- Conduct patient assessments to support clinical pharmacy services, including pediatrics, pain management, and critical care cases
- Collaborate with healthcare providers on medical management plans, medication therapy reviews, and patient care strategies
- Utilize pharmacy software, EMR (Electronic Medical Records), and EHR (Electronic Health Records) systems for accurate documentation and data management
- Provide immunizations and educate patients on medication administration, physiology, anatomy, and medical terminology to enhance understanding and compliance
- Supervise pharmacy technicians, ensuring proper medication dispensing and inventory management.
- Participate in local Community health events.
- Maintain compliance with all regulatory standards related to pharmacy practice, including HIPAA privacy rules
Requirements
- Valid pharmacist license with current registration in the applicable jurisdiction.
- Completion of a pharmacy residency program or equivalent clinical pharmacy experience
- Strong knowledge of physiology, anatomy, medical terminology, and medication administration protocols
- Experience with pharmacy software systems, EMR/EHR platforms, and inventory management tools.
- Demonstrated ability to perform patient assessments within an acute care environment
- Knowledge of immunizations procedures and vaccination protocols
- Excellent communication skills for patient service and interdisciplinary collaboration
- Ability to manage multiple priorities efficiently while maintaining attention to detail
- Prior pharmacy technician supervision experience is highly desirable
